EXCLUSIVE: Character Breakdowns for Netflix’s ‘XO Kitty’

With production slatted for March 2022, Netflix’s XO Kitty is looking to cast two recurring guest star roles for the series.

Netflix looks to be adding to its cast for the forthcoming XO Kitty series.

A spinoff of the popular To All the Boys… films, XO Kitty focuses on the youngest Covey sister, played by Anna Cathcart. The series follows teen matchmaker Kitty Song Covey who thinks she knows everything there is to know about love. When she moves halfway across the world (Korea) to reunite with her long-distance boyfriend, however, she’ll soon realize that relationships are a lot more complicated when it’s your own heart on the line.

As we’ve previously revealed, XO Kitty will enter production in March 2022. While the series was previously looking to fill the role of six main characters, it looks like episode two of the show will introduce two recurring guest star roles: Madison and Florian.

Madison is described as being a 17-year-old white American female who is as American as Apple pie. Her family, naturally, made a fortune by creating apple pie in a cup and she’s spent her summers working at the family bakery in the past. However, having grown tired of cheerleading and boys with their pick-up trucks, Madison is seeking a change with Korea. Believing Korea to be a great place to expand their apple pie in a cup business, her parents agree to send her to a boarding school in Korea with the hopes of learning the culture and language. Unfortunately, though, Madison often tries way too hard to fit in at her new school and it becomes clear she’s a teen simply trying to find herself. The role is that of a recurring guest star; actors applying need to be at least 18-years-old.

Florian is a 17-year-old male who describes himself as queer; he also identifies as femme or androgynous. Florian is an art and history buff who has a knack for seeming pretentious, but truly just loves pop culture. He has a crush on a typical jock at the boarding school, and soon finds himself in a “will they or won’t they” with the athlete Q. The role is that of a recurring guest star; actors applying need to be at least 18-years-old. The hope is to also cast someone who identifies as queer.

XO Kitty is a spinoff of the popular Netflix To All the Boys… adaptations based on the books by bestselling author Jenny Han. XO Kitty appears to be an original series that came about because of the movies and their popularity. Han is the TV series creator and co-wrote the pilot script with fellow author, Siobhan Vivian. As it stands XO Kitty does not yet have a release date.
